Bottom line

Irákleion is the warmer of the two — about 11°C on the annual average; Irákleion is the wetter, with 135 mm more rain a year.

Warmer Irákleion 11°C on the year
Wetter Irákleion 135 mm more a year
Sunnier Tusayan 4 pp less cloud
Colder winters Tusayan 19°C colder nights

Methodology & sources

Irákleion

Temperature & precipitation — 1991–2020 normals computed from 21 years of daily observations at Heraklion, a weather station, about 4 km from the city centre. The underlying daily records come from NOAA's global station network.

Cloud, humidity, wind & sunshine — modelled estimates from NASA POWER, NASA's satellite-and-reanalysis climatology. This is the standard global source for atmospheric variables, which are not measured at most weather stations.

Tusayan

Temperature & precipitation — 1991–2020 normals computed from 24 years of daily observations at Grand Canyon NP AP, a weather station, about 4 km from the city centre. The underlying daily records come from NOAA's global station network.

Cloud, humidity, wind & sunshine — modelled estimates from NASA POWER, NASA's satellite-and-reanalysis climatology. This is the standard global source for atmospheric variables, which are not measured at most weather stations.
